  2. On 5/13/2020 at 6:46 AM, mdgeek said:

    Any updates on whether or not this worked?

    No more reboots for me after doing this.  I still have the error and loss of instrument cluster audio info on my Tacoma dash until I restart the unit but steering wheel controls work and audio doesn’t cut out. Apparently there’s a firmware now for Maestro RR for TO2 called reboot. You may be able to flash it without calling ADS, but you may need to give them your account username so they can add it. I haven’t tried yet. 

  3. Sorry, following up Again. Made a jumper from the black/red wire to the red wire from the radio and capped the end going Into the RR per Maestro support. This will isolate the issue if it’s actually maestro related or radio related. Pretty sure the power goes directly to the radio now and not though the maestro. We’ll see if this fixes it.
